Tuesday, March 8, 2011

The Adventures of Alex the Ape: Dr. Ludlow

Dr. Ludabell L. Ludlow is the proverbial mad Scientist whose grandiose dreams for total domination of Mystic Island are constantly being thwarted by Alex and his friends. Ludlow is selfish, mean, jealous, venal, conceited, power hungry and those are his good points.

